Welcome to Lester ...

The town of Lester is located in Limestone County<1>.

While we don't have a date for the founding of Lester, you might consider that their post office opened in 1938.

From the  Census Estimates for 2019, Lester has a population of 131 people<2> (see below for details).

Lester is 750 feet [229 m] above sea level.<3>.

Time Zone: Lester lies in the Central Time Zone (CST/CDT) and observes daylight saving time

Area Codes for Lester: 256 & 938<4>

The ZIP code for Lester: 35647<5>

Population Details ...

Taken from the 2019 Census Estimates, Lester had an population of 131 people. This is an increase of 18.02% since the 2010 Census (or an increase of 22.43% since the 2000 Census).

At the time of the 2010 Census, Lester had a population of 111 people. This makes Lester the county's 4th most populous community.

With a 2010 count of 111 people, the population of Lester increased 3.74% from the 2000 Census (which had a count of 107 people).

Communities Also Named Lester ...

Using our Gazetteer, we found that there are two Alabama communities named Lester: This one is located in Limestone County and the other is located in Etowah County.

Beyond Alabama, there are 23 communities that are also named Lester - they are located in Arkansas (2), Colorado, Georgia (2), Illinois, Indiana, Iowa (2), Kansas (2), Michigan, Minnesota, Nebraska, New York,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Utah, Washington and West Virginia.

<4>When there's a risk of an area code running out of phone numbers, an 'Overlay Area Code' is created that has the same geographic boundaries as the existing area code. In this case, the 256 code has been Overlayed with the 938 area code. New phone numbers in the Lester area will be assigned with one of these codes: 256 or 938. As a result, placing a call in the Lester area will require 10-digit dialing (where you enter both the area code and then the phone number).
